On Friday, Russia’s ambassador to Washington compared the state of US-Russia relations to an “ice age” and warned of a “high” risk of a direct clash between the pair. A Russian official also warned that Moscow might cut oil output next year in response to price caps on its crude and oil products introduced by the EU and G7.
